by Tiffany Lee (Author), Reginald Petty (Author)

Endorsed by East St Louis Mayor From John Robinson's fight for African American schools in the late 1800's to President Obama's recent historical appointment of Staci Yandle, over 100 years of East St. Louis African American History is covered in Legendary East St. Louisans: An African American Series. Legendary East St. Louisans covers well-known East St. Louisans such as; Miles Davis, Jackie Joyner-Kersee and Reginald Hudlin. Additionally, readers are introduced to lesser-known pillars of the early African American community such as Carrie K. (Johnson) Bowles, one of the first African American women to join The League of Women Voters of St. Louis, and to fight alongside famed suffragist Edna Gellhorn; and Dr. Henri Weathers who fought to allow African American doctors to practice at local hospitals. He was also one of the first African American doctors hired by St. Louis University Medical School. Eugene B. Author Biography

Reginald Petty is a native East St. Louisan, retired U.S. Government administrator, activist, and historiographer for the city of East Saint Louis, Il. Tiffany (Grimmett) Lee is a native East St. Louisan, a communications professor, writer, and founder of TiffanyRose Publishing.
